A former Anthony, Texas, police officer pleaded guilty today in 243rd District Court to a civil rights violation on allegations he received sexual favors in exchange for not taking a woman to jail during a traffic stop in 2002. Officer Lorenzo Lozoya, 33, and fellow officer Eduardo Casillas, 31, were accused of stopping a woman on suspicion that she was driving while intoxicated in Anthony on April 15, 2002. The uniformed officers then took her to a desert area where she was allegedly offered the choice of performing oral sex instead of going to jail, complaint affidavits stated. Lozoya and Casillas were later arrested by detectives with the El Paso County Sheriff s Office. Casillas is scheduled to go to trial in February. www.elpasotimes.com/breakingnews/ci_4735033
